Fishing is great at the Rideau Lakes, some of the species are Rock Bass, Northern Pike, Large and Small Mouth Bass, Crappie, Walleye and Lake Trout. Kayak and Stand up paddle boards are available on site. Our dock fits boats up to 20 feet, welcome to bring and dock your own boat. A short drive from our oasis, you will find many hiking trails including the following: ⦁ Perth Wildfire Reserve: A well-treed, loop trail to a lookout with a great view of the Tay Marsh. It is a 3km, easy route with lots of birds to see along the way. ⦁ Sylvan Trail at the Murphy’s Point Provincial Park: A 2.5 km loop that leads you through a mature, mixed forest community with a rugged landscape.
